I've tried googling and searching here, but can't see what I'm looking for...

So.

Is it possible to assign (through software or hardware) multiple network drives - wether firewire or ethernet or eSATA the network isn't set up yet so options are still open - a single drive letter.

Dealing with very large files with access points in various places, but dont want to have to hunt around for things... lets say I want video I want it all on one "drive" even if that's made up of several network drives. This would also allow for cheaper expansion that the big enclosures.

NO. What your asking for is a raid over network which I don't believe is possible.

What I would do is make a directory on one NAS drive and then put a short cut to it in your Network Places folder. No more searching.
